"This is a useful work. It fills a gap in the historical literature by addressing the bureaucracy and its functioning over a long period."--Hispanic American Historical Review"This volume fills some significant gaps in our understanding of colonial governance."--The Americas"A meticulously researched book . . . the evidence presented and the conclusions offered are valuable for understanding the formation of the Mexican nation."--Locus
